Job Description: Maki Maker / Sushi Roller

We are looking for a fast, detail-oriented, and skilled Maki Maker to join our kitchen team. If you specialize in rolling sushi and enjoy working in a dynamic, high-volume environment, we want to hear from you!

Requirements:

  • Proven experience as a Maki Maker or Sushi Line Cook
  • Capacity to efficiently roll 100+ rolls per day quickly, tightly, and with consistent visual appeal
  • Basic prep skills (handling sushi rice, cutting vegetables, and preparing roll fillings)
  • Experience working in Eastern European cuisine environments (e.g., Ukraine, Kazakhstan, Belarus) is a strong advantage
  • Excellent attention to detail, cleanliness, and strict adherence to food quality standards
  • Ability to maintain speed and efficiency during peak dining hours
  • Team-oriented mindset with a positive attitude

Responsibilities:

  • Produce a high volume of sushi (100+ rolls daily) according to our recipes and presentation standards
  • Complete daily prep work for the maki station (preparing rice, slicing vegetables, organizing fillings)
  • Ensure all orders are made in a timely manner, especially during busy rushes
  • Maintain strict cleanliness and organization of your workstation throughout the shift
  • Follow all food safety and hygiene regulations
  • Work collaboratively with the Sushi Chef and the rest of the kitchen staff

What we offer:

  • Stable full-time position
  • Competitive pay (based on experience and rolling speed)
  • Friendly and professional team
  • Organized kitchen workflow
  • Opportunity for long-term employment and growth
